Editor’s note

A magazine for people who stay.

Weekend alpine tourism has its own internet. AlpeanGlow is for the other rhythm: the professional who wants two months in Laax, the family planning a winter in Arosa, the couple testing whether an Engadin village can become a second home.

The site is built as a journal because that is how this market should feel — edited, dated, a little selective. New & unmissable. Luxury lodging. Workation gems. Cabins in nature. Four editorial desks, refreshed as new stays arrive.

The name is the light that stays on the high snow after the sun has gone: alpenglow. We are interested in what remains when the day-trippers have taken the last train.
